Accommodation in Tighnabruaich
Tighnabruaich, nestled on the stunning west coast of Scotland, is an enchanting destination that promises a delightful stay for visitors seeking a tranquil escape. This picturesque village, known for its breathtaking views of the Kyles of Bute, offers a variety of accommodation options, including charming hotels, cosy B&Bs, and welcoming guest houses. The warm hospitality found in Tighnabruaich ensures that every guest feels right at home.
Staying in Tighnabruaich provides easy access to a myriad of outdoor activities, making it an ideal base for nature lovers and adventure seekers alike. The surrounding areas boast beautiful coastal walks, where you can soak in the stunning landscapes and marvel at the rich wildlife. The nearby Argyll Forest Park also offers opportunities for hiking and exploring lush woodlands, adding to the area's natural allure.
For those interested in history and culture, Tighnabruaich features notable landmarks such as the beautiful Victorian church, adding a touch of architectural charm. The village is also conveniently situated near the historic town of Dunoon and the scenic Isle of Bute, providing further exploration opportunities.
Local dining options highlight the region’s culinary scene, with eateries serving fresh seafood and other local delicacies. Visitors can enjoy a meal with a view, enhancing their experience in this picturesque setting.
